Would it be possible to run an lnf head and ecu on an lsj? Could this work with an s/c'ed setup? Would it show good gains on a turbo lsj? Just wondering if it'd be worth it for getting direct-injection and vvt?
lol, well the bottom end is the same right? Could you buy the intake manifold, exaust manifold, head, ecu and find your own turbo and intercooler? I know it was a dumb question if you could put it on a s/c'ed lsj, but why wouldnt it work if you swapped all those parts off an lnf?

google the lnf and read up on it you will see they are not alike as you would think...
the head would bolt onto the block, and the timing chain would lign up, and im sure the intake and exhaust manifold would bolt up, but im guessing thats were it ends. the complecations of making the direct injection work is not worth it. swapping in the lsj injection wouldnt work as there are no bosses in the head for the injectors, as well as the prots in the head will be designed as a dry port, so fuel wouldnt properly mix in the port. making the vvt work is another huge hassle, best bet would be to run a 2.4l pcm and tune it for s/c.
easier idea would be to supercharge an lnf, wich is pointless. if you want vvt, build up a 2.4l and supercharge it. or best of all, just have your head ported with decent valves, springs and cams, and you will see the best gains.

Well, the idea would be to use the lnf ecu and injectors aswell... but your right, I'd probably be better off porting my head and buying some decent cams. I'm just curious what kind of total cost, and what kind of gains you'd see from basically just keeping the lsj block,sleeves,rods and crank, the same f35 tranny, then just swapping everything else from an lnf minus the turbo and fmic, and putting a bigger turbo and fmic on there. I'm guessing until we see some wrecked 08+ ss's, or solstice gxp/ sky redline in a junkyard to buy parts off of, the parts will all be pricey from gm...
